As light reflects off a mirror the angle between the incident ray and reflected ray of light is 50°. What is the angle of reflection?

Respuesta :

by law of reflection, the angle of incidence = the angle of reflection

so if the angle between incident ray and reflected ray is 50°

angle of incident + angle of reflection = 50
°
2*angle of reflection = 50
°
angle of reflection = 50/2 = 25
°

Answer:

it would be 25
